Unsafe Condition

A damaged wiring harness, resulting from chafed wires due to interference with under-floor attachment fittings of the cabin partition net caused by incorrect routing on the production line, which can lead to an electrical short and potential loss of essential safety functions.

Required Actions

Inspect the electrical wiring harness at frame C14 and between frames C16 and C17 for wire chafing and incorrect routing. If wire chafing or incorrect routing is found, repair and reroute the electrical harness before further flight.

Compliance Time

Within 100 hours time-in-service or 12 months after May 20, 2009, whichever occurs first.

Affected Aircraft

EADS SOCATA Model TBM 700 airplanes, serial numbers 434 through 478, certificated in any category.
